Aurora: The provincial government of Aurora was awarded the Balangay Seal of Excellence by the Philippine Drug Enforcement Agency (PDEA) in recognition of its sustained efforts to maintain all its eight municipalities as drug-cleared. Governor Isidro Galban and Provincial Administrator Sherwin Taay received the award from PDEA representatives at the provincial capitol on Monday.
According to Philippines News Agency, the Balangay Seal of Excellence is the highest recognition granted by PDEA to local government units that demonstrate exemplary performance in implementing anti-illegal drug initiatives, particularly the Barangay Drug Clearing Program. PDEA Aurora officials said the award reflects the collective efforts of the provincial government, municipal and village officials, law enforcement agencies, and community stakeholders in combating illegal drugs and promoting public safety.
Earlier Monday, PDEA Aurora also participated in the first quarter meetings of the Provincial Peace and Order Council, Provincial Anti-Drug Abuse Council, and Provincial Task Force to End Local Communist Armed Conflict. The meeting, presided over by Galban, Vice Governor Patrick Alexis Angara, and other officials, discussed updates on the Drug-Free Workplace Program, peace and order developments, anti-drug efforts, and insurgency situation.
Officials emphasized continued inter-agency collaboration to sustain Aurora's drug-cleared status, strengthen peace and order mechanisms, and address emerging security concerns.
